When it comes to wildfires, defensible space might be the difference between staying covered — and being left in the ashes.

In this episode of Rooted in Care, guest Keith Jackson of KSTJ Insurance Services tackles a hot topic: how wildfire risk, property upkeep, and insurance access intersect—and what communities can do to stay safe and stay covered.

With wildfires intensifying and insurers tightening their requirements, Keith shares what it takes to stay insured when you’re in the line of fire. From maintaining a 5–10 foot defensible space to the rising use of drone inspections and stricter application reviews, he breaks down how smart tree care can reduce liability and help safeguard your policy.

Keith sheds light on what it really means to live in a Firewise community. His advice? Don’t let aesthetics get in the way of action. Bring in a certified arborist (like A Plus Tree), clear out those flammable gutters, and don’t ignore a non-renewal notice — it’s your cue to act fast.

Don’t wait for change to come to you — take action now. Create defensible space, stay on top of tree care, and most importantly, reach out to your insurance agent. A quick chat with your agent could mean the difference between protection and panic.
